The ICRU recommendations for reporting intracavitary therapy in gynaecology and the Manchester method of treating cancer of the cervix uteri.

J M Wilkinson1, T P Ramachandran.   

Abstract

The recommendations of the International Commission on Radiation Units and Measurements for reporting intracavitary therapy have been considered with particular regard to the Manchester method of treating cancer of the cervix uteri. The total reference air kerma is calculated and tabulated as a function of prescription for the standard Manchester applicator arrangements. Furthermore, it is shown that the volume contained within a particular isodose surface may be determined, with very acceptable accuracy, from the total reference air kerma by the use of a simple empirical expression.
